表面
How to Understand
表面 refers to the physical surface of something or the outward appearance, especially when it may not reflect the true nature or underlying reality. It emphasizes what is visible or presented, rather than the internal or hidden aspects.
The character 表 (biǎo) originally meant 'to write' or 'to express,' and later came to mean 'surface' or 'appearance.' 面 (miàn) means 'face' or 'surface.' Together, they form a term that captures the idea of an external layer or presentation.
表面 is commonly used in both literal and metaphorical contexts. For example, it can describe the surface of an object or the superficial impression someone gives. In Chinese culture, there's often a strong emphasis on appearances, so understanding 表面 helps grasp nuances in social interactions and communication.
